Instyle98 240 Posted January 10, 2013 ErinSue2000, Here's the list I have from my doctor: unjury, smoothie King Gladiator High Protein/Low Carb, Labarada Lean Body, EAS Myoplex Low Carb/Lite, BSN Syntha-6 Core Series, Isopure (20 oz bottle), Nature's Best Zero Carb Isopure (2 scoops), Nectal, Protein Shots (dilute in Propel), IDS Sports New-Whey 42 liquid Protein, Myoplex (regular), Myoplex Lite (2 scoops), Muscle Milk Lite, Worldwide Sport Pure Protein, whey isolate Protein (1 scoop) Protein Powdered Mixes - A good Protein Drink should have the following nutrients per serving: +20 grams protein per scoop/serving, 7 grams or less of carbohydrate/sugars per scoop/serving, 5 grams or less of fat per scoop/serving Hope that helps you with finding a Protein Drink.< /p>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
